Same here, that is WAY out of our price range, we have the Graco one from Target, the duodiner and love it. It can lean forward or back, the height is adjustable and it can come off the legs, and the top of the tray comes off to put in the dishwasher. The color we got, its not an eyesore, its dark brown including the legs, and with the wheels we just roll it in and out of the pantry when we need it.

The only thing I really care about in a high chair is if the fabric part comes off easily to wash, if the tray is easy to remove, and if it reclines.
